About Jindalee 4074

The size of Jindalee is approximately 3.1 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 18.5% of total area. The population of Jindalee in 2011 was 5,111 people. By 2016 the population was 5,295 showing a population growth of 3.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Jindalee is 40-49 years. Households in Jindalee are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Jindalee work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 80% of the homes in Jindalee were owner-occupied compared with 79.2% in 2016.

Jindalee has 2,040 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Jindalee have seen a 99.73%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 72.50% increase. As at 30 September 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Jindalee is $1,134,240 while the median value for Units is $874,707.
  • Houses have a median rent of $730 while Units have a median rent of $538.
